Title:
METHOD FOR IMPREGNATING SUBSTANCE INTO FOOD MATERIAL

Abstract:
[Problem] To provide a novel method whereby a large amount of a substance can be impregnated into a food material within a short period of time. [Solution] A method for impregnating a substance into a food material, wherein an impregnation driving force is generated by taking advantage of a phase transition phenomenon of water in the food material under reduced pressure and thus the substance is impregnated into the food material while maintaining the shape thereof so as to make the food material recognizable from the appearance, said method being characterized by comprising: subjecting the food material to a decompression treatment, thus boiling water in the food material under reduced pressure and inducing vaporization of water and volume expansion of steam in the food material so as to increase the volume thereof; then subjecting the food material, which is in contact with the impregnation substance, to a boosting treatment, thus inducing steam volume shrinkage and condensation of steam in the food material so as to decrease the volume thereof, and then generating an impregnation driving force, thereby impregnating the substance into the food material.
